But the piece that truly sets this hostel apart from others is its location in Vidigal. I cannot express enough about what a cool place it was to visit, and about how silly you are if you chose not to go here because you are scared of the label "favela." Vidigal is one of the most exciting and vibrant communities I've ever stumbled into. It is incredibly lively--it doesn't matter whether it is 3AM on a weeknight or 9AM on a weekend, there are always people out and about, and bars, shops, and even beauty salons seemingly available at all hours! It's chaotic and steep (like, really steep), and moto-taxis zoom around every corner (if you aren't willing to take the 15 minute hike to the hostel a moto-taxi will take you there for about USD 1) but the community is quite clean and the people are very open.||||In terms of access to the rest of the city, it's really not that much of a problem. With the new subway system in place, you can easily get to where you want to go just by taking a quick 10 minute bus ride (or 20 minute walk) from the base of Vidigal to the nearest stop. Leblon and Ipanema (beaches that are way better than Copacobana) are right around the corner.||||Go to...
